Hopton Hall Lane is in Mirfield and in Kirklees district. WF14 8EL is located in the Mirfield elect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Dewsbury.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is Hopton Hall Lane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Hopton Hall Lane was 29.7 per 1,000 residents, which is 63.1% lower than the Mirfield average. The most reported crime type was Vehicle crime.

Hopton Hall Lane has the 11th lowest crime rate of 64 local areas in Mirfield and the 238th lowest crime rate of 1,334 local areas in Kirklees .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 11.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-31.4%.

Employment

WF14 8EL area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 1%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in WF14 8EL area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 44%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
